About the Role
As an IT Intern, you'll assist end users with day-to-day support requests, onboard and offboard users including laptop and mobile build/configuration, and learn about network and system administration in an enterprise setting.
You'll gain hands-on experience supporting SG Fleet's infrastructure and service delivery while developing your technical problem-solving skills.
Key Responsibilities
Assist end users with daily support requests across SG Fleet systems
Onboard and offboard users, including laptop and mobile build/configuration
Learn and support network and system administration in an enterprise environment
Maintain IT asset records and assist with hardware/software lifecycle management
Collaborate with the IT team to improve service delivery and user experience
Participate in team meetings and contribute to process improvement initiatives
Who We Are
SG Fleet is a leading financial services provider specializing in fleet management, vehicle leasing, and salary packaging.
With operations across Australia, New Zealand, and the UK, we manage over $2.5 billion in assets and employ more than 1,200 people.
Our culture is built on innovation, collaboration, and a commitment to delivering exceptional customer experiences.
